Student file of Leslie Nephew, a member of the Seneca Nation, who entered the school on October 19, 1902, and departed on July 2, 1907. The file contains a student information card, a returned student survey, former student response postcards, a trade/position record card, and a report after leaving that indicates Nephew was a farmer in…

Student information card of Leslie Nephew, a member of the Seneca Nation, who entered the school on October 19, 1902 and departed on July 2, 1907. The file indicates Nephew was living in Versailles, New York in 1913 and 1915.
